The Loft is a spacious, apartment-style suite with two beds (one king bedroom, one queen bed curtained off from the living room) and a comfortable living room with a gas fireplace and western views, facing Perins Peak. A dining room and full kitchen, including fridge, stove and oven, coffeemaker, plateware and silverware, breakfast nook and private bath make up the entirety of the Loft. The Loft is accessed by its own private entrance with a large staircase next to the Rochester Hotel and is also pet friendly.* Rates based on four person maximum occupancy. To further expand your local Western film knowledge, each room has a copy of" Hollywood of the Rockies" (Durango’s former nickname), researched and written by local author Fred Wildfang. This book offers additional insight into Durango’s role in such films as Around the World in Eighty Days, The Cowboys, and The Naked Spur, just to name a few.
